The Resident Evil franchise continues to maintain a significant global influence on the gaming industry as it approaches its 30th anniversary. Originally released in 1996 by Capcom, the series popularized the survival horror genre through its unique blend of resource management, atmospheric tension, and puzzle-solving. With over 160 million copies sold across more than 170 titles and versions, the series remains relevant by evolving its gameplay styles and narrative depth. Its enduring legacy is sustained by iconic characters and a dedicated community that celebrates both its classic horror roots and modern technical innovations.
- Resident Evil was created by Shinji Mikami at Capcom and debuted in 1996, drawing inspiration from the Japanese horror game Sweet Home.
- The series is credited with defining the “survival horror” genre, prioritizing atmosphere and limited resources over high-action combat.
- The franchise has achieved massive commercial success, selling more than 160 million units globally across its various entries.
- Beyond video games, the property has expanded into a multi-billion dollar media franchise including live-action films, animated series, and merchandise.
- The series has successfully adapted to changing technology, moving from fixed camera angles and “tank controls” to modern third-person and first-person perspectives.
- A dedicated fan community remains active through speedrunning, cosplay, and the documentation of the series’ “campy” dialogue and cultural impact.
